Lipsticks are made in three phases. First, the raw ingredients are heated separately in containers. Then the liquefied oils as well as color pigments are combined. When the mix is ready to be poured, it's placed in tubing molds. After removing the molds and the lipsticks that resulted are ready for packaging. The mixture is then made into a roller mill. The oil and pigment are mixed and air is introduced into the mix. The air is removed through mechanical stirring.
After the raw ingredients are mixed, they are poured into an evaporator. Then, the colors are added to the liquefied oils. Next, stir the mixture to eliminate any air bubbles. The lipstick can be packaged once the pigments have been fully incorporated into wax. This process takes a few hours and is completed using the aid of a roller mill. The makeup of mac lipsticks shades varies from brand to brand, however, the primary ingredients are waxes and oils. The structure and shape of lipsticks is influenced by waxes. There are a variety of waxes that can be utilized to create lip products, like beeswax. It is the primary ingredient in lipsticks and is comprised of more than 300 chemical compounds. It is a complex chemical composed of hydrocarbons and esters.
